What is a pushchair?

A pushchair or buggy is a must for any baby who wishes to go out. It allows parents to bond with their newborn or baby and be able to enjoy the time with their family.

However, selecting the best pushchair for your child is a major decision, and there are a lot of different options available. Direct4Baby recommends that you consider all options prior to making any purchase. You should take into consideration a variety of factors, including your child's age and how often you will use the product.

There are a variety of pushchairs on the market, from single buggies to triple ones. The majority of standard pushchairs can be used for babies up to four years old. They are designed with safety in mind and have features that ensure your baby is secure. For example, most come with five-point harnesses that hold your baby's in place and stops them from swaying out of their seat. It is secured by two straps that wrap around shoulders, two on the hips, and one between their legs.

Some pushchairs are designed to accommodate twins side by side or in a tandem, while others can be used to accommodate a car seat pram seat or carry cots, and therefore are more like travel systems. It is important to choose a product that will offer your child maximum comfort and convenience, whether you choose a double or triple pushchair.

The biggest difference between a pushchair and a pram is that a pushchair is suited for children who can sit up in chairs and is typically directed towards the front. A pram is made specifically for newborns and infants. It usually comes with the bassinet or carry cot. Prams are sometimes converted into pushchairs, which allows you to change between the two as your baby grows.

Many pushchairs feature the option of reclining seats. This allows your baby to sleep flat. This is crucial for babies as they are advised to sleep flat for the first few weeks of their life to improve their breathing and head control abilities.

What is the difference between an infant pushchair and a baby pram?

A pushchair is a similar product to a stroller but it is designed specifically for babies that can sit up straight. They often include a seat that can be adjusted to various reclining positions. They also come with an safety harness to keep your child secure. They are lightweight and compact and are able to be easily moved on different terrains. A lot of pushchairs are adjustable, meaning your baby can face you for reassurance or the world to explore their surroundings.

Prams, on the other hand, are geared towards newborns and infants. They usually have a large and sturdy carrycot that your baby can rest in, as well as soft walls and a comfortable mattress. Most prams have a parent-facing design so your baby can see you, which is crucial to build trust and strengthen bonds. However as your baby grows they may begin to look at the world around them more and will struggle to get into a sitting position in their pram. This is the time to change to a pushchair.

You'll also find prams that can be converted into strollers or pushchairs, which are perfect if you need to switch between the two as your baby grows. They'll typically have a carry cot and frame that you can remove to allow your baby to be in a comfortable position from birth and then a pushchair seat when they're ready to go.

It's important to check that the seat of a pushchair is able to be fully reclined, as this is crucial for newborns. It isn't easy to verify this feature, as many pushchairs simply say they are'reclining however this doesn't mean they are able to lie down. It's best to look for a pushchair that can be used from birth or a pram travel system, or combination pram that has the carry cot and is suitable for use starting at birth.

It's important to consider how easy your pushchair is to clean, as there'll likely be more drools and spills than you'd think. You should be able easily to clean the seat and chassis.

What should I be looking out for when buying a pushchair?

A pushchair is likely to be one of your biggest baby purchases. So it's worth thinking carefully about the finer details before spending your hard-earned cash.

The most important aspect is whether the product meets your family's needs and lifestyle. If you're likely to be on-the-go a lot, you will want a lightweight compact pushchair which can fold down into a smaller size to fit in the car boot.

If you have twins or babies who are similar in age You may want to purchase a double stroller that can seat both children at the same time. You might also want to purchase a footmuff, or a parasol to provide extra comfort and to protect your child from the sun.

You should also think about whether you'll be satisfied with the design of the pushchair and if it will still look good prams after the next few years. You'll likely be using your pushchair for a number of years, so it is important to pick a style you like.

Quality and type of wheel are equally important, since you want a pushchair that can handle different terrains, such as grass and pavements. You can upgrade the wheels on the majority of pushchairs to all-terrain durable wheels that permit you to travel off-road or in muddy fields.

In the end, if you'll be taking your pushchair with car seat regularly up and down stairs, it is advisable to look for one with an easy and efficient folding mechanism. Some models can be folded and unrolled with one hand, while others are freestanding when folded, making them easy to transport up and down the stairs.
